Abstract
Methods, systems, and computer readable media can be operable to facilitate the mapping of packet identifiers to a constant value. A multimedia device may receive one or more pieces of multimedia content and may select a constant PID value for each of one or more component streams associated with the content. The multimedia device may map PIDs of each respective one of the one or more component streams to a constant PID value designated for the component type of the respective component stream. The multimedia device may replace the PIDs of each component stream with constant PID values such that each component stream type includes the same PID value for the entirety of the stream. The modified component streams, each having continuity with respect to PID values, may be stored as a recording or output to a device for viewing.
